""It felt like we were ready to play, it felt like we were in a good mindset," Matthews said. "I thought the first ten minutes they came out strong, and the next ten minutes I thought we controlled play, then I just thought we had too many passengers throughout the rest of the game. We just weren't on the same page.""
""This quote got fans into a frenzy for a couple of reasons. Was Matthews, who didn't have a point in the loss, referring to himself as one of the passengers, too? Was he calling out the entire team? And if so, why were there too many passengers? Who decided to show up and take it easy in by far the most important game of the season?""
The Toronto Maple Leafs lost Game 7 at home to the Florida Panthers by a 6-1 score and were largely uncompetitive. Captain Auston Matthews said the team had 'too many passengers' and that players were not on the same page. Fans debated whether Matthews included himself among the passengers or was singling out teammates and asked why key players appeared to underperform in the most important game. The loss triggered meaningful roster change: Mitch Marner later left for the Vegas Golden Knights and the Leafs entered their first season without the 'core four' label.
